**The Escalating Crisis**

Hurricanes, wildfires, floods, and other natural disasters are becoming more frequent and severe. The economic impact of these events is skyrocketing, leading to significant financial strain on insurance companies. Traditional risk assessment models, which have historically relied on historical data, are proving to be inadequate. As a result, insurers are being forced to revise their strategies and explore new avenues for managing climate-related risks.

**Innovative Insurance Solutions**

Insurers are increasingly turning to technology and data analytics to enhance their predictive capabilities. Advanced modeling techniques, such as machine learning and artificial intelligence, are being employed to better understand and anticipate the effects of climate change. These technologies allow insurers to develop more accurate risk profiles and pricing models, ensuring that they can offer sustainable coverage options in the face of evolving environmental threats.

**The Role of Reinsurance**

Reinsurance plays a crucial role in managing the financial risks associated with climate change. By spreading the risk across multiple insurers, reinsurance helps to mitigate the impact of catastrophic events on individual companies. However, the reinsurance market itself is experiencing significant challenges, with increasing premiums and tightening capacity. The interplay between primary insurers and reinsurers is becoming more complex, requiring careful navigation to ensure the stability of the industry.

**Regulatory Landscape**

Governments and regulatory bodies are playing an increasingly active role in shaping the insurance response to climate change. New regulations and guidelines are being introduced to ensure that insurers adequately assess and disclose climate-related risks. Compliance with these regulations is becoming a critical aspect of doing business in the insurance industry. Insurers must stay abreast of evolving regulatory requirements and integrate them into their risk management frameworks.
